The Ultimate Buying Guide: Choosing Natural Wet Cat Food
Switching to natural wet cat food is a great step for your feline friend’s health. Wet food offers excellent hydration and often mimics a cat’s natural diet. But how do you pick the best one? Use this guide to become a savvy shopper.
Key Features to Look For
When you look at a can or pouch, check these things first. These features tell you a lot about the food inside.
- High Animal Protein Content: Cats are obligate carnivores. They need meat! Look for a high percentage of real meat (like chicken, turkey, or fish) listed as the first few ingredients.
- Moisture Level: Natural wet food should be very moist—usually over 70% water content. This helps keep your cat’s kidneys and urinary tract healthy.
- Complete and Balanced Nutrition: The label must state that the food meets AAFCO (Association of American Feed Control Officials) standards for your cat’s life stage (kitten, adult, or all life stages).
- No Grains or Fillers: Good natural food avoids cheap fillers like corn, wheat, and soy.
Important Ingredients Matter Most
The quality of the materials used directly impacts how healthy your cat will be. Focus on what goes *in* the can.
Protein Sources
Prioritize whole meat sources. Look for ingredients like “chicken,” “salmon,” or “duck.” Avoid vague terms like “meat by-products” if you are aiming for top quality. Fish is great, but make sure it is sustainably sourced if possible.
Healthy Fats
Fats provide energy. Good fats come from fish oils (like salmon oil) or flaxseed. These often contain essential Omega-3 and Omega-6 fatty acids, which keep skin and coats shiny.
Vitamins and Minerals
Natural food should contain essential vitamins like Taurine. Taurine is critical for a cat’s heart and vision. It must be added because cats cannot make enough of it themselves.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Not all “natural” foods are created equal. Understand what boosts quality and what lowers it.
Quality Boosters:
- Human-Grade Ingredients: While not always required, using ingredients fit for human consumption usually means higher standards were followed.
- Limited Ingredient Diets (LID): If your cat has sensitivities, LIDs use fewer ingredients, making it easier to pinpoint allergens.
- Paté vs. Chunks in Gravy: Paté often packs more meat into a smaller space than chunky styles, which might contain more water or broth fillers.
Quality Reducers (What to Avoid):
These ingredients often signal a lower-quality product, even if the brand claims to be natural.
- Artificial Colors and Preservatives: Natural food should use natural preservatives like Vitamin E (tocopherols). Avoid BHA or BHT.
- Excessive Vegetable Matter: While some vegetables add vitamins, too many (like carrots or peas) replace necessary meat protein.
- Carrageenan: This is a thickener sometimes used in canned food that some studies link to digestive upset.
User Experience and Use Cases
How the food works in your home is just as important as what is on the label.
Palatability (Taste Test)
If your cat won’t eat it, the ingredients do not matter! Some cats resist a sudden switch to a new texture or flavor. Introduce new foods slowly over a week. If your cat is a fussy eater, you might need to try several brands before finding a winner.
Serving and Storage
Wet food must be refrigerated after opening. Plan to feed your cat within two to three days of opening a can or pouch. Small portions are easier to manage. For multi-cat homes, larger cans are more economical, but be mindful of spoilage.
Use Case: Hydration Support
If your veterinarian has recommended increasing your cat’s water intake (common for older cats or those prone to urinary issues), natural wet food is the easiest solution. It provides a significant portion of their daily hydration needs in every meal.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Natural Cat Food Wet
Q: Why is natural wet food usually more expensive than dry food?
A: Natural wet food costs more because it uses higher quality, often whole-meat ingredients. It also requires less processing and fewer cheap fillers like corn or grain.
Q: Is “grain-free” the same as “natural”?
A: No. While many natural foods are grain-free, “natural” simply means the food does not contain artificial colors, flavors, or preservatives. Always check the ingredient list for quality protein.
Q: How much wet food should I feed my cat daily?
A: This depends on your cat’s weight, age, and activity level. Always follow the feeding guidelines on the specific can, but generally, an average adult cat needs about one 5.5 oz can per 10 pounds of body weight daily, split into two meals.
Q: Can I mix wet food with dry food?
A: Yes, mixing is fine! Many owners use wet food as a supplement to increase hydration and palatability while using dry kibble for convenience. Just be sure to adjust the total daily serving amounts.
Q: What does “AAFCO Statement” mean?
A: AAFCO sets the nutritional standards for pet foods in the US. If the food has an AAFCO statement, it means the recipe has been formulated to provide complete and balanced nutrition for your cat.
Q: My cat prefers chunks, but paté seems healthier. What should I choose?
A: Choose the texture your cat reliably eats. While paté often has a higher meat density, if your cat refuses it, you are wasting money. If they eat chunks, ensure the chunks are suspended in broth rather than thick gravy made with gums.
Q: How long can opened wet cat food stay in the fridge?
A: You should feed your cat the opened wet food within three to four days. Cover it tightly or transfer leftovers to an airtight container before refrigerating.
Q: Are there any risks to feeding only wet food?
A: No, feeding 100% high-quality wet food is excellent for hydration. The main concern is ensuring the wet food is “complete and balanced” according to AAFCO standards so your cat gets all necessary nutrients.
Q: What is the role of vegetables in natural cat food?
A: Vegetables are used to add fiber, moisture, and certain vitamins. However, they should never replace the primary source of protein, which must be meat.
Q: How do I transition my cat to a new natural wet food?
A: Transition slowly to avoid stomach upset. Start by mixing a small amount (about 25%) of the new food with their old food. Over seven to ten days, gradually increase the ratio of the new food until you are feeding 100% of the new natural brand.
